can i use this as a walkthrough mod for any game if yes how thank you
It's not a walkthrough mod, but can be used as a cheat mod. If you use this in combination with UnRen, you can usually find the system variables that can be edited to, for example, give you more love or relationship points, money, inventory items, etc.

No, it's not a replacement for a Gallery mod, either. If you use UnRen and option 3, then Shift-D to get to the developer console, you can view the system variables there. If you also use URM it's a lot easier to keep track of those variables dynamically with the "watch" feature in it, and adjust them as you see fit. (I think using the console from UnRen is awkward, personally.) But you're right about being careful with your edits, some games will break if you change variable values.

You could use URM to create a gallery mod. While playing through the game you could use URM to remember scenes and save those. And if you share this URM file others could enjoy your gallery.

As for you comment on breaking games by changing variables. Software is never 100% bug free and developers shouldn't have to take into account that variables could change from outside their own code. On the other hand, I would take this into account. It's good practice to also take those unexpected values into consideration, because if you don't you could accidentally break you own code at some point. Or something unexpected could break your code.
I've looked at a lot of Ren'Py code (not talking about Summertime Sage, I haven't checked this code) and there is a lot of really bad coding in a lot of Ren'Py games, but is this really a problem? A game is a lot more then some coding, but I think renders and dialogue are more important in this context. I wouldn't expect someone to be brilliant at 3D modelling, script writing and coding. Those are completely different skills.
